Magic Slim plus the Teardrops had been the epitome of Uncooked-edged Chicago blues. Slim's totally aggressive, rhythm-pushed sound showed not a trace of slickness. His tunes carried on within the unvarnished variety of the '50s and '60s Windy City blues masters, and he assisted retain that tradition alive.
Slim was also recognized for possessing Potentially the largest repertoire of any blues artist, constantly able to pick up A different song from your radio or perhaps the jukebox, enabling him to record above thirty albums and garner dozens of Blues New music Awards nominations. His son Shawn “Lil Slim” Holt is ably carrying around the household blues custom.

Magic Slim led Probably the most relentless, hard-driving bands in Chicago blues heritage for many decades until his Demise in 2013. Born Morris Holt in Mississippi in 1937, he attained his nickname from his Close friend and fellow blues guitar ace Magic Sam.
They returned to Chicago because of the mid-Sixties, this time once and for all, and began a recording job in Magic Slim 1966 With all the music “Scufflin’,” the primary inside a number of singles that led at some point to his to start with album, Born Beneath a Bad Indicator
Slim, born Morris Holt in Mississippi, helped determine the sound of put up-war electric blues in Chicago for a younger peer of icons like Muddy Waters and Howlin’ Wolf. Slim’s initially instrument was piano, but following he missing the small finger on his ideal hand within a cotton-gin incident, he switched to guitar, as well as performed bass along with his mentor, the guitarist Magic Sam.
Slim as well as the Teardrops turned Probably the most recorded Chicago bands, with albums on labels like Blind Pig, Proof, and Wolf documenting their proudly tough and tough form of Chicago blues. The band appeared at golf equipment and festivals throughout the world, suitable up till Slim's Demise on February 21, 2013
